WebApr 14, 2024 · With the PHE expiration, telehealth was set to go away. In the early days of the pandemic, the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) waived the limitation on which providers could offer telehealth services —meaning that PTs, OTs, and SLPs were eligible to begin using telehealth with patients for the duration of the COVID-19 emergency. WebMar 21, 2024 · HHS OIG and the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) have both made it clear that federal program payment for (1) items or services furnished by excluded individuals or entities, and (2) salaries, expenses, or fringe benefits of excluded individuals (regardless of whether they provide direct patient care) are prohibited.
